- Fórum WMO
- → Viewing Profile: Posts: Acid House
Community Stats
- Group Usuários
- Active Posts 179
- Profile Views 2161
- Member Title Foresight Linux User
- Age 38 years old
- Birthday January 21, 1987
-
Sexo
Não informado
-
Interesses
php + balada + mulhé
Posts I've Made
In Topic: Trabalhando Com Array
14/08/2006, 17:00
procurei e não axei outra forma, axo que esta é a unica e a mais viavel =]
In Topic: Dúvidas Sobre Mysql
14/08/2006, 16:55
SELECT campos FROM tabela WHERE campo = "nome_do_programa" ORDER BY id DESC
ve se isso ajuda =]
In Topic: Classe Mysql : Resource Id #
06/08/2006, 02:03
xo ver se eu entendi.......
Pelo geito q vc tá excrevendo sua classe em PHP5, certo?
se for eu dei uma mexida nela...
<?PHP class mysql { private $db_host = "localhost"; private $db_user = "root"; private $db_senha = ""; private $db_banco = "db"; private $conexao; private $db; public function __construct() { $this->conexao = mysql_connect($this->db_host,$this->db_user,$this->db_senha) or die (mysql_error()); if($this->conexao) { $this->db = mysql_select_db($this->db_banco,$this->conexao) or die (mysql_error()); } } // Executa query geral public function sql($query) { $resultado = mysql_query( $query ) or die (mysql_error($this->conexao). " : " .nl2br($query)); return $resultado; } // Retorna o total de linhas da query public function num_rows($query) { $resultado = mysql_num_rows($query) or die (mysql_error($this->conexao). "Erro : ".nl2br($query)); return $resultado; } // Retorna um array da query public function fetch_array($query) { $resultado = mysql_fetch_array($query) or die (mysql_error($this->conexao). " : ".nl2br($query)); return $resultado; } } ?>
Agora vc instancia um objeto assim
$db = new mysql;
pra chamar uma função
mysql::sql("COMANDO SQL");
só uma coisa cara não entendi o pq vc fez uma função nova pra cada coisa.....
vc pode fazer isso aqui
<?PHP class mysql { private $db_host = "localhost"; private $db_user = "root"; private $db_senha = ""; private $db_banco = "db"; private $conexao; private $db; /** * Função constutora. * Conecata ao banco de dados... **/ public function __construct() { $this->conexao = mysql_connect($this->db_host,$this->db_user,$this->db_senha) or die (mysql_error()); if($this->conexao) { $this->db = mysql_select_db($this->db_banco,$this->conexao) or die (mysql_error()); } } /** * Esta função verifica o login * o retorno desta fução é um valor boolean, caso o camarada esteja no sistema retorna true senão false **/ public function verifica_login( $_USER_ID ) { $sql = "SELECT nome FROM tabela WHERE idLogin = '$_USER_ID';"; $dataSet = mysql_query( $sql ); if ( mysql_num_rows( $dataSet ) > 0 ) { return true; } else { return false; } } } ?>
dai faz assim
<?PHP require_once( "classe.php"); $db = new mysql; if ( mysql::verifica_login( id do usuario ) ) { echo " vc está logado"; } else { echo "vc não está logado"; } ?>
espero que seja isso... qaulquer coisa se não for posta ai q amanha qdo tiver melhor eu leio e tento ajudar =]
In Topic: Onclick
06/08/2006, 01:40
ao certo não lembro se é nome ou id q tem q setar..... .. qualquer coisa pota ai q amanha eu te ajudo, pq eu já fiz isso...
( só naum ajudo agora pq eu acabei de xegar de um aniversário... to vendo 3 monitores ao inves de 2... axo que alguem colocou um no meio dos dois %))
In Topic: Pagina.php/isso/aquilo/mais/aquele/outro...
30/07/2006, 16:33
me manda uma mp que eu te passo ele..
Ok, supondo que vc tenha uma pasta de tutoriais e nela uma página que exibe os tutoriais pelo nome da categoria. No .htacess coloque essas duas linhas:
RewriteEngine on
RewriteRule tutoriais/(.*) tutoriais/tutoriais.php?categoria=$1
Salva como .htaccess na raíz do seu servidor e digite no seu browser:
http://seusite.com/tutoriais/php
ele vai entrar nesta página:
http://seusite.com/t...p?categoria=php
Você pode fazer isso com o que quiser, ids, seções, etc. Só tenha certeza de criar uma nova linha Rewrite Rule para cada URL.
Bom, mas o meu problema é outro.
Ok, o ModRewrite está funcionando.
Mas, como eu faço para que as URLS no meu site levem diretamente às URLS modificadas, como neste site: http://vexels.net.
Eu pensei em str_replace, mas, daí me veio a cabeça de que se eu mudar as URLs sem avisar aos meus arquivos, eles não vão mais conseguir pegar os dados com o $_GET['algumacoisa'].
Alguém tem uma solução?
- Fórum WMO
- → Viewing Profile: Posts: Acid House
- Privacy Policy
- Regras ·